Transaction 521fb8944913ede1ee857875e2e08d32fdfaa14dc93810b0633242a14a60a3aa
1 Input
1 Output
-
521fb8944913ede1ee857875e2e08d32fdfaa14dc93810b0633242a14a60a3aa:0
- value
- 1363800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1abdde9031723ae4a2a4bb754a09876b94250b48 OP_EQUAL
- address
- 348QwtSQnVtNtFZYZMnXtsV5YYYYRSVMe7